Transaction 21ee386b49093d4098cb1c41d1e8ea2f68b95e1f650a62b9efcd2d098cc00dc2
1 Input
2 Outputs
- 21ee386b49093d4098cb1c41d1e8ea2f68b95e1f650a62b9efcd2d098cc00dc2:0
- 21ee386b49093d4098cb1c41d1e8ea2f68b95e1f650a62b9efcd2d098cc00dc2:1
value 1417165
address 3DhfLjZQzPzhnjH2dfgX6VZ658Xi1NSYry
value 50108
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c